## Slack to Google Chat Migration Tool

Migrates Slack workspace JSON exports into Google Chat spaces via the [Google Chat Import API](https://developers.google.com/workspace/chat/import-data-overview).

### Features

- Imports all messages (including threaded replies)
- Uploads attachments into Google Drive with name+MD5 deduplication
- Migrates emoji reactions using per-user impersonation
- Posts channel metadata (purpose/topic) from `channels.json`
- Retries API calls on transient errors with exponential backoff
- Logs in structured JSON for easy Cloud Logging ingestion
- Filters channels via `config.yaml`
- Automatically generates user mapping from users.json
- Maps external emails to internal workspace emails
- Includes comprehensive reports for both validation runs and actual migrations
- Identifies users without email addresses for mapping
- Automatic permission checking before migration
- Checkpoint-based resumption for interrupted migrations

### How It Works

This tool uses the [Google Chat Import API](https://developers.google.com/workspace/chat/import-data-overview) to migrate Slack data into Google Chat. Important things to know about import mode:

- **Spaces are created in import mode** — they are hidden from users until import is completed
- **90-day deadline** — Google automatically deletes spaces that remain in import mode for more than 90 days
- **No notifications** — messages imported in import mode don't trigger notifications for users
- **No link previews** — URLs in imported messages won't generate link previews
- **Drive-preferred attachments** — file attachments are uploaded to a shared Google Drive and linked in messages (Google recommends Drive for imported content)
- **Archival limitations** — Google Chat's space archive/read-only features are not available during import mode; spaces become fully active once import completes

### Migration Process and Cleanup

#### Per-Channel Process

The migration processes each channel through the following stages:

```mermaid
flowchart TD
    A[Create Space in Import Mode] --> B[Add Historical Members]
    B --> C[Post Channel Intro\npurpose / topic]
    C --> D[Import Messages\nattachments & reactions]
    D --> E{Errors?}
    E -->|No| F[Complete Import Mode]
    E -->|Yes| G{import_completion_strategy}
    G -->|skip_on_error| H[Leave in Import Mode]
    G -->|force_complete| F
    F --> I[Add Regular Members]
    I --> J[Channel Complete]
    H --> K[Channel Skipped\nneeds cleanup]
```

1. **Create Space**: Creates a Google Chat space in import mode
2. **Add Historical Members**: Adds users who were in the Slack channel (with `createTime`/`deleteTime` for accurate membership history)
3. **Send Intro**: Posts channel metadata (purpose/topic) as the first message
4. **Import Messages**: Migrates all messages with their attachments and reactions
5. **Complete Import**: Finishes the import mode for the space
6. **Add Regular Members**: Adds all members back to the space as regular members

#### Error Handling

The tool provides several configurable options for handling errors during migration:

1. **Abort on Error**: When enabled (`abort_on_error: true`), the migration will stop after encountering errors in a channel. When disabled (default), the migration will continue processing other channels even if errors occur.

2. **Maximum Failure Percentage**: Controls how many message failures are tolerated within a channel before skipping the rest of that channel (`max_failure_percentage: 10` by default). If the failure rate exceeds this percentage, the channel processing will stop.

3. **Import Completion Strategy**: Determines how to handle import mode completion when errors occur:
   - `skip_on_error` (default): Don't complete import mode if there were errors
   - `force_complete`: Complete import mode even if there were errors

4. **Cleanup on Error**: When enabled (`cleanup_on_error: true`), spaces with errors will be deleted during cleanup. When disabled (default), spaces with errors will be kept (allowing manual completion).

5. **API Retry Settings**: Configure how API calls are retried when errors occur:
   - `max_retries: 3` (default): Maximum number of retry attempts for failed API calls
   - `retry_delay: 2` (default): Initial delay in seconds between retry attempts

These options can be configured in your `config.yaml` file:

```yaml
# Error handling configuration
abort_on_error: false
max_failure_percentage: 10
import_completion_strategy: "skip_on_error"
cleanup_on_error: false

# API retry settings
max_retries: 3
retry_delay: 2
```

#### Cleanup Process

After all channels are processed, a **cleanup process** runs to ensure all spaces are properly out of import mode. This cleanup:

1. Lists all spaces created by the migration tool
2. Identifies any spaces still in "import mode" that weren't properly completed
3. Completes the import mode for these spaces with retry logic
4. Preserves external user access settings where applicable
5. Adds regular members to these spaces

The cleanup process is important because spaces in import mode have limitations and will be automatically deleted after 90 days if not properly completed.

#### Checkpoint and Resumption

The migration tool writes a checkpoint file (`.migration_checkpoint.json`) in the Slack export directory to track progress. This file records:

- Which channels have been fully processed (with completion timestamps)
- When the migration started
- When the checkpoint was last updated

If a migration is interrupted (e.g., by a crash or `Ctrl+C`), the checkpoint allows the tool to skip already-completed channels on the next run. The checkpoint file is automatically removed after a successful migration completes.

> **Note:** The checkpoint tracks channel-level progress only. If a migration is interrupted mid-channel, that channel will be reprocessed from the beginning on the next run.

### Known Limitations

#### Google Chat Import API Constraints

These are limitations of the [Google Chat Import API](https://developers.google.com/workspace/chat/import-data-overview) itself, not specific to this tool:

- **90-day import mode limit** — spaces left in import mode for more than 90 days are automatically deleted by Google
- **No link previews** — URLs in imported messages don't generate link previews
- **No duplicate `createTime`** — two messages in the same space cannot have the same `createTime` timestamp; the tool handles this by incrementing timestamps when collisions occur
- **No notifications during import** — users don't receive any notifications for messages imported in import mode
- **External user limitations** — external users (outside your Google Workspace domain) cannot be impersonated via domain-wide delegation; their messages are attributed to the workspace admin with sender annotation
- **No native attachments** — the Import API doesn't support native file attachments on messages; files are uploaded to Google Drive and linked in message text (this is Google's recommended approach for imported content)

#### Tool-Specific Limitations

- **Thread Continuity in Resume Mode**: When using `--resume` to resume an interrupted migration, messages that are part of threads started in the previous migration may not be correctly threaded with their parent thread. This occurs because the tool only imports messages newer than the last message in each space, and thread replies to older messages are posted as new standalone messages instead of being properly attached to their original thread context.

- **Limited External User Support**: The migration tool has several limitations when dealing with external users (users outside your Google Workspace domain):
  - External users cannot be impersonated due to Google Chat API restrictions, so their messages are posted by the workspace admin with attribution text indicating the original sender
  - Emoji reactions from external users are dropped and not migrated
  - External users are not automatically added to migrated spaces — only internal workspace users receive space memberships during migration

- **Attachment Handling**: When Slack attachment files are uploaded to Google Drive during migration, a link to the Google Drive file is appended to the end of the message content rather than being attached as a native Google Chat attachment. This preserves access to the files but changes how they appear in the migrated conversations.

- **Formatting Limitations**: Caveats related to migrating Markdown formatting from Slack to Google Chat, including:
  - Nested bullet lists may not indent correctly in Google Chat, causing subbullets to appear as manually indented bullets that do not wrap correctly.
  - Bold styling around user mentions (e.g., `*<@USER>*`) is not supported by Google Chat and will display literal asterisks.

#### Manual Google Cloud Setup (Without Using the Script)

If you prefer not to use the setup script, follow these steps manually:

1. **Enable required APIs in Google Cloud Console**:
   - Go to [Google Cloud Console](https://console.cloud.google.com/)
   - Navigate to "APIs & Services" > "Library"
   - Search for and enable these APIs:
     - Google Chat API
     - Google Drive API
     - Admin SDK API

2. **Create a Service Account**:
   - Go to "IAM & Admin" > "Service Accounts"
   - Click "Create Service Account"
   - Give it a name (e.g., "slack-chat-migrator")
   - No project-level IAM roles are needed (permissions come from delegation)

3. **Create and Download a Key**:
   - In the service account details page, go to the "Keys" tab
   - Click "Add Key" > "Create new key"
   - Select JSON format and download it
   - Save this file as `slack-chat-migrator-sa-key.json` in your project directory

4. **Configure the Chat App**:
   - Go to the [Chat API Configuration](https://console.cloud.google.com/apis/api/chat.googleapis.com/hangouts-chat) page in the GCP Console
   - Set an App name (e.g. "Slack Migrator")
   - Set Avatar URL (e.g. `https://developers.google.com/chat/images/quickstart-app-avatar.png`)
   - Set Description (e.g. "Slack to Google Chat migration")
   - Leave Interactive features **disabled** (the migration uses server-to-server API calls, not a bot)
   - Click Save

5. **Set Up Domain-Wide Delegation**:
   - Go to your [Google Workspace Admin Console](https://admin.google.com/ac/owl/domainwidedelegation)
   - Navigate to Security > API Controls > Domain-wide Delegation
   - Add a new API client with the client ID from your service account key file
   - Grant these OAuth scopes:
     - `https://www.googleapis.com/auth/chat.import`
     - `https://www.googleapis.com/auth/chat.spaces`
     - `https://www.googleapis.com/auth/chat.messages`
     - `https://www.googleapis.com/auth/chat.spaces.readonly`
     - `https://www.googleapis.com/auth/chat.memberships.readonly`
     - `https://www.googleapis.com/auth/drive`
